The Killis Melton Ice Cream Crank-Off
McKinney, TX

One of the best ways to beat the summer heat is with a big bowl of homemade ice cream.  Even though it's a Texas tradition and a summer survival necessity, homemade ice cream has become scarce in most areas.  However, in McKinney they celebrate the creamy confection every August during the Killis Melton Ice Cream Crank-Off.  As the story goes, originally the people of McKinney had a chili cook-off.  
However soon it was suggestion by McKinney resident Killis Melton that ice cream would be a better for for summer and the rest is history.
 

Ice Cream "Crankers" compete in an informal competition and at the end everyone gets free ice cream.  What could be better than that?
